Your SprintPCS Connection Card

Your Sprint PCS Connection Card fits into aType II PC Cardslot (available on most notebook PCs) and functions as a wireless network card.

This card allows you to:

CDMA Networks

The Sprint PCS Connection Card operates over a type of wireless network called CDMA (Code Division Multiple Access).

To use the Sprint PCS Connection Card, you need an account that gives you access to a CDMA network.

Every CDMA network operates on one of three radio frequency bands. Your Sprint PCS Connection Card PC-5740 leverages the high-speed CDMA 1xEV-DO nework and operates on the 1900 MHz band.

The Sprint PCS Connection Card utilizes CDMA 1xEV-DO technology enabling real-time high-speed wireless access to email, the Internet, or your company network. The card runs on most current Windows-compatible laptop or desktop computers, and it provides data transmission of up to 2.4 Megabits per second (Mbps) (average speed of 300-800 kbps before bandswidth optimization).

Tip: More information about CDMA networks is available on the CDMA Development Group Web site,www.cdg.org.
